Skip to content

Commit 261e445

Browse files
authored
Merge pull request #13 from mtielen/Enable_writing_values
Bugfix await
2 parents d042505 + b8a1b92 commit 261e445

File tree

2 files changed

+5
-4
lines changed

2 files changed

+5
-4
lines changed

setup.py

Lines changed: 1 addition &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-5,7 +5,7 @@
55

66
setuptools.setup(
77
name='wolf_comm',
8-
version='0.0.14',
8+
version='0.0.15',
99
author="Jan Rothkegel",
1010
author_email="jan.rothkegel@web.de",
1111
description="A package to communicate with Wolf SmartSet Cloud",

wolf_comm/wolf_client.py

Lines changed: 4 additions & 3 deletions
Original file line numberDiff line numberDiff line change
@@ -58,9 +58,9 @@ def __init__(self, username: str, password: str, lang=None, client=None, client_
5858
self.language = None
5959

6060
if lang is None:
61-
lang = 'en'
62-
63-
self.load_localized_json(lang)
61+
self.l_choice = 'en'
62+
else:
63+
self.l_choice = lang
6464

6565

6666
async def __request(self, method: str, path: str, **kwargs) -> Union[dict, list]:
@@ -118,6 +118,7 @@ async def fetch_system_state_list(self, system_id, gateway_id) -> bool:
118118

119119
# api/portal/GetGuiDescriptionForGateway?GatewayId={gateway_id}&SystemId={system_id}
120120
async def fetch_parameters(self, gateway_id, system_id) -> list[Parameter]:
121+
await self.load_localized_json(self.l_choice)
121122
payload = {GATEWAY_ID: gateway_id, SYSTEM_ID: system_id}
122123
desc = await self.__request('get', 'api/portal/GetGuiDescriptionForGateway', params=payload)
123124
_LOGGER.debug('Fetched parameters: %s', desc)

0 commit comments

Comments
 (0)